An overgrown park is again under threat after councillors gave permission for a house to be built on it.

The land in Hackney Close is owned by Hertsmere Borough Council. At an Elstree and Borehamwood planning committee meeting last Thursday, councillors approved plans for a four-bedroom house on the site.

The committee said if the council sold the land for redevelopment, some money should be used to provide another park in the area for younger children.

Neighbouring resident Brian Kaye, who spoke against the proposal, said: “I am fed up with this council. If it cannot sell the land straight away, that piece of land is going to be left in that mess instead of the parks department doing their job properly and keeping it maintained as they should have done all this time.”
